How would you like to do your first marathon in under 3 hours. Ya, me too! The quote from the article gave me some solace as I finished the marathon in 4 hours and 50 minutes and could barely walk across the finish line too.
Armstrong’s time was 2 hours, 59 minutes and 36 seconds. His shirt soaked in sweat, he virtually walked the last couple of steps to the finish line. He shuffled into a post-race news conference, his right shin heavily taped.
I guess it is all relative - here you have a super athlete struggling to walk across the finish line under 3 hours and many others struggle at 5 hours. That is what is so cool about running.
